Reference specification
| Item | Value |
|---|---|
| Model | Havana 2 |
| Brand | Esco Bars |
| Category | Vape Pens |
| Battery | 1000 mAh |
| Output range | 5-30 W |
| Capacity | 1.2 ml |
| Charging | USB-C fast charge |
| Coil options | 0.8 / 1.2 ohm |
| Carton quantity | 240 units |

Checklist
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.
- Verify that artwork matches the approved compliance template.
- Check carton quantities against the commercial invoice line by line.
- Review the reorder point after one full selling cycle.
- Confirm the exact configuration in writing before the deposit is paid.
- Log sell through by account for the first eight weeks.

Frequently asked questions
How should Havana 2 be set up for the first time?
Charge fully, prime the coil, wait a few minutes, then start at the lowest comfortable setting.
Is documentation provided for customs?
Commercial invoice, packing list and the relevant certificates are supplied; the importer's broker handles the declaration.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
How quickly can a repeat order be produced?
For established configurations production typically runs two to four weeks, with transit on top depending on the chosen method.
